One or more of the following sensations may occur as a result of sciatica:
Pain in the rear or leg that is worse when sitting
Burning or tingling down the leg
Weakness, numbness or difficulty moving the leg or foot
A constant pain on one side of the rear
A shooting pain that makes it difficult to stand up
Low back pain may be present along with the leg pain, but usually the low back pain is less severe than the leg pain

Symptoms that may constitute a medical emergency include progressive weakness in the leg or bladder/bowel incontinence.... In general, patients with complicating factors should contact their doctor if sciatica occurs, including people who:... have unexplained, significant weight low(loss)....
